The image depicts a long, covered concrete walkway or veranda alongside a building in Barakin Akawo, Nigeria. The walkway is lined by a series of square columns supporting a ceiling fitted with white patterned panels. The walls and columns of the building are plastered and painted a faded light orange/peach color, exhibiting signs of wear, staining, and cracks. Faint white markings are visible on the building's wall, which also features multiple dark-framed doors or windows, some appearing ajar. The concrete floor of the walkway is worn, dusty, and uneven, with scattered debris and small depressions. Long, distinct shadows are cast across the walkway and floor by sunlight originating from a low angle. Beyond the columns, an exterior environment is visible, including a dirt path, green vegetation, distant utility poles, and other structures with light-colored walls and dark roofs. In the far distance, between columns, a small group of indistinct figures, possibly individuals wearing blue attire, are faintly discernible near a utility pole.
